Sensormatic SA and Techpro merge

November 2003 News & Events, Entertainment and Hospitality (Industry)

Sensormatic SA, the southern African business partner of Sensormatic Electronics Corporation, part of the global Tyco Fire and Security Group, has announced that it has merged with Techpro, a long-established independent security systems integrator specialising in the entertainment and hospitality industries.

According to David Pople, Sensormatic SA marketing manager, the move provides a platform for both businesses to offer greatly improved service to customers and to springboard into new market areas.

"Over the past year or two, the South African security industry has already experienced a degree of consolidation, having seen substantial investment from international security companies such as Securicor, ADT and Chubb," said Pople. "The merger of Sensormatic SA and Techpro is however the most significant yet between major local companies. With the industry moving rapidly to a digital platform, the market is demanding more sophisticated design solutions, as well as products and services that deliver efficiencies beyond traditional security. This greater critical mass will enable us to deliver on both of these promises."

Sensormatic SA has established a dominant position within the South African urban surveillance market, as well as in providing loss-prevention and surveillance solutions to the local retail industry. It is rapidly broadening its base internationally, running projects in the Middle East, the Far East as well as Eastern Europe. Techpro specialises primarily in casinos and hotels, meeting the bulk of the unique surveillance requirements of these markets. The combined entity promises combined annual turnover in excess of R200 million, making it arguably the largest private and locally-owned security company within South Africa.

Comments Iain Foxon, Techpro managing director, "Sensormatic's and Techpro's businesses are highly complementary, and we envisage that our customers will benefit substantially from Sensormatic's world-class product range and its infrastructure of customer support and delivery."
